diff options
| author | Markus Törnqvist | 2013-05-18 13:19:52 +0300 |
|---|---|---|
| committer | Markus Törnqvist | 2013-05-18 13:24:36 +0300 |
| commit | 85faebbb75e65b89c3b6e6103943d4bf6ca0b2c1 (patch) | |
| tree | 779a469e6643c376a11cd5e7a5cc4136d35d5d77 /rest_framework/serializers.py | |
| parent | b950b025bc66e3018d5f74e1494ff17f7742be75 (diff) | |
| parent | 5d7d51ed9d24e98eaa2d34592db1781d1ea3230f (diff) | |
| download | django-rest-framework-85faebbb75e65b89c3b6e6103943d4bf6ca0b2c1.tar.bz2 | |
Merge branch 'mikee2185-master' into mjtorn-master
Conflicts:
rest_framework/fields.py
rest_framework/serializers.py
rest_framework/tests/models.py
rest_framework/tests/serializer.py
Fixed all the conflicts.
Diffstat (limited to 'rest_framework/serializers.py')
| -rw-r--r-- | rest_framework/serializers.py |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/rest_framework/serializers.py b/rest_framework/serializers.py index 7707de7a..942ab399 100644 --- a/rest_framework/serializers.py +++ b/rest_framework/serializers.py @@ -724,6 +724,12 @@ class ModelSerializer(Serializer): kwargs['choices'] = model_field.flatchoices return ChoiceField(**kwargs) + if model_field.verbose_name is not None: + kwargs['label'] = model_field.verbose_name + + if model_field.help_text is not None: + kwargs['help_text'] = model_field.help_text + try: return self.field_mapping[model_field.__class__](**kwargs) except KeyError: |
